The 2022 Hero World Challenge is hosted by Tiger Woods. It's a 20-man field with no cut and the winner will collect $1 million of the $3.5 million prize pool. Six of golf's top-10 ranked golfers will tee off. Jon Rahm won the tournament in 2018 and was runner-up a year later.
